Position Description
- Nursing faculty are professionals with the education and practice skills to prepare the next generation of nurses.
- Faculty members are accountable to the Dean/Director of Nursing for the implementation of the approved curriculum based on the mission and philosophy of the nursing program and the College/Campus.
- They provide students with opportunities to acquire the knowledge and practice the skills identified in course objectives using varied and appropriate teaching methods.
- They plan learning activities to meet program outcomes based on the standards set by policies, legal and other regulatory requirements, and acceptable practice.
- Faculty also participate in the program’s evaluation and continuous improvement process and engage in personal professional development.
Requirements
- Completion of an accredited professional nursing education program.
- A current active unencumbered license as a registered nurse in the state of NY or a multistate privilege to practice in NY.
- A master’s degree in nursing from an accredited program (Practical Nursing programs BSN may be acceptable depending on local need).
- Previous teaching experience preferred.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ills and analytical skills.
- Excellent teaching and classroom management skills
- Functional abilities to carry out classroom, clinical and laboratory teaching responsibilities
- Competence in clinical skills in areas of teaching
- Competent in personal computer applications: word processing, spreadsheet, database, and email.
- Successful completion of criminal background check and drug screening, required immunizations, current CPR and HIPAA certifications.
- Provides annual documentation of continuing professional growth at the employee’s expense.
